9 Daiso Products That Are Totally Worth Your $2

19 Apr, 2016

Here's a list you never knew you needed! No more spending unnecessarily on anything anymore!

9 Daiso products that are so worth your $2

9 Daiso products that are so worth your $2

Daiso has been the go-to store for Singaporeans who are looking for cheap-everything! This convenience store from Japan sells everything at a static price, regardless of size and product purpose. I mean, $2 everything? Why not?

You're looking for a completely new but cheap cutlery set? Daiso! You're looking for cheap but good (not even kidding!) make up? Daiso!

Still not convinced? Here's our list of reasons on why you should spend $2 on a Daiso product as compared to anywhere else.

Badminton Set

Badminton Set

Image credit: moneysmart

The Badminton Set consists of one racket and one shuttlecock, which to be honest, it is the ultimate value-for-money item you can find in Daiso. Sure, it won't turn you into a professional but come on, you'll be all badminton ready after just spending $2! All you've got left to do is get into the right attire and you're good to go!

Caramel Corn

Caramel Corn

Image credit: sweets.seriouseats

This caramel corn tidbit is a must-buy for almost everyone who visits Daiso. Some even come to Daiso for the sole purpose of getting this! Its salty and sweet taste combination and puffiness is so addicting, it can actually serve as a form of comfort food.

In most Daiso stores in Singapore, there are usually 2 full racks filled with just this! Heads up, this product contains peanuts and lard!

Charcoal Peel Off Mask

Charcoal Peel Off Mask

Image credit: ebay

The Charcoal Peel Off Mask has been tried and tested on quite a number of beauty videos and websites and is probably one of the most talked about product from Daiso. Made in Korea from all natural ingredients, it minimises facial pores, removes oil and dirt and leaves your skin smooth and soft.

It has received countless positive reviews and thumbs up that its shelves have to be restocked every single day!

Compression bags

Compression bags

Image credit: daisojapan

Personally, Daiso is the only place where I would purchase my compression bags. Not only do they work perfectly well, they also come in various sizes. Some can go as big as 100cm x 110cm!

Heat packs

Heat packs

Image credit: tripzilla

Heat packs for $2?! Does that spell value-for-money or what? Daiso's heat packs work in a matter of minutes and are beneficial for travelling to cold countries or even if you're just not a fan of cold temperatures in general!

Makeup products

Makeup products

Image credit: theblackmentosbeautybox

There are panels after panels of make up products in Daiso. They have toners, foundations, eyeliners and all of them come in different shades and types, to suit different preferences. Many are skeptical about this because naturally, we think cheap make up doesn't equals to good results.

However, the make up products at Daiso have been tried and tested by beauty gurus and they too, like the previously mentioned charcoal mask, have received positive reviews!

Plastic organisers

Plastic organisers

Image credit: daisojapan

How often do we head to convenience stores in search for plastic organisers only to get surprised at how expensive they are? Some can even go up to $16 just for one! Daiso plastic organisers are long-lasting and they come in a wide variety of choices, all for just $2 each!

Tissues

Tissues

Image credit: daisojapan

Be it tissues or wet wipes, Daiso sells good quality ones. They even come in different scents like orange or lemon! Their wet wipes also do not have a rough texture. They come in different packaging sizes and are especially convenient for travelling purposes.

Tweezers

Tweezers

Image credit: daisojapan

Ever bought an over $5 pair of tweezers only to be frustrated that it either doesn't work or in some cases, breaks after 3 tries? I have! Daiso tweezers are not only long lasting, it's actually better than most of the other tweezers out there. Yes, it may not work as well as the branded ones but it sure does its job well!

Mummies, if you have any other items to recommend from Daiso, do share them with us!
